Technically Streamline Moderne only refers to a period style of, primarily American,
Architecture, not streamline design in general. The application of the term to anything
Streamline is of very recent origin and an artifact of the internet rather than scholarship
and design histories.

Wikipedia is one of the worst purveyors of mixed up crap and flat-out incorrect statements
when it comes to discussion of art and design of the period.

The Modern Era and/or The Machine Age are both better descriptors for the period.
